    Anza-Borrego Desert State Park (/ ˈ æ n z ə b ə ˈ r eɪ ɡ oʊ /, AN-zə bə-RAY-goh) is a California State Park located within the Colorado Desert of Southern California, United States. Created in 1932, the park takes its name from 18th century Spanish explorer Juan Bautista de Anza and borrego , a Spanish word for sheep. [ 2 ]

    Indian Wells was a stop on the Butterfield Overland Stage line. [1] The Indian Wells post office, located 10 miles (16 km) west of El Centro operated from 1876 to 1877. [ 1 ] The site of Indian Wells was obliterated by the 1906 flood of the New River , when the Colorado River changed course and filled the Salton Sea , scouring a deeper and ...

    Yaqui Well is a historic spring located in Anza-Borrego Desert State Park in southeastern San Diego County, California in the United States about 21.4 mi (34.4 km) east of Warner Springs. [2] The watering hole can be reached by a popular 1.64 mi (2.64 km) one-hour (round trip) hiking trail starting at Tamarisk Grove Campground. [3]
